As a Brake Operator at MGM Products Inc. you will be responsible for operating various fabrication machines (Press Brakes Lasers) and carrying out the daily tasks assigned by the supervisor. This operator can successfully setup and operate the machinery from beginner to intermediate setups. Works closely with supervisor and production planning on the full scope of projects moving through the department. Operator is flexible and adaptable to assignment changes and will jump in and help when needed. Ensures a safe and efficient operation of the machine and conducts quality control checks on the first part and throughout the production run. Our products are custom configured and made to order.


Additional responsibilities will include:

  • Sets up and operates equipment to bend parts of sheet metal according to drawings or product specifications.
  • Read drawing work orders or production schedules to determine specifications such as quantity dimensions and/or tolerances.
  • Performs periodic checks on output; measures completed parts to verify conformance to specifications.
  • Maintain high level of productivity and produce quality parts.
  • Identify equipment production and/or parts issues; troubleshoot issues with management and appropriate personnel.
  • Performs preventative maintenance tasks to maintain equipment performance and prevent machine downtime.

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Prior CNC machine operating experience required
  • Mechanical and Technical Capacity
  • Basic Math Aptitude
  • Attention to Detail
  • Problem Solving/Analysis
  • Teamwork Capacity
  • Communication Proficiency
  • Ability to read and interpret technical documentation (e.g. blueprints drawings etc.)
  • Ability to work independently.
